Kinds Of Exercise Bikes
When it comes to exercise bikes, there are primarily 3 types: upright bikes, recumbent bikes, and spin bikes. Each type serves a various purpose and deals with varying physical fitness goals.
| Kind of Bike | Description | Perfect For |
|---|---|---|
| Upright Bike | Imitates a conventional bicycle, focusing on an upright position and interesting core muscles. | Casual riders and those developing endurance. |
| Recumbent Bike | Offers a reclined seating position with a larger seat and back assistance, putting less pressure on the back. | Those with back pain or joint concerns. |
| Spin Bike | Developed for high-intensity workouts, including a heavy flywheel for a smooth ride and adjustable resistance. | Advanced users looking for a cycling class experience or robust exercises. |
Advantages of Using Exercise Bikes
Low Impact on Joints: Exercise bikes provide a low-impact cardiovascular exercise, making them appropriate for people with joint issues or those recuperating from injuries.
Cardiovascular Health: Regular cycling can substantially improve heart health, increasing your cardiovascular endurance and reducing the risk of heart illness.
Weight Loss and Management: Combining stationary bicycle workouts with a healthy diet can assist in considerable weight loss. An individual weighing 155 pounds can burn approximately 260 calories in 30 minutes at a moderate strength on an upright bike.
Convenience: Exercise bikes are compact and easily suit home settings, permitting users to work out without the need for a gym.
Personalized Workouts: Most exercise bikes feature different resistance levels that can be changed based upon the user's fitness level, making sure progression gradually.
Engagement and Versatility: Many modern bikes come equipped with innovation that enables users to follow structured exercises, track progress, or even join virtual classes, adding an interesting component to indoor cycling.
Functions to Consider
When picking an exercise bike, it's necessary to consider the following functions to ensure you pick one that aligns with your physical fitness goals and choices.
| Feature | Significance |
|---|---|
| Comfort | Look for adjustable seats and handlebars to keep proper type and convenience during exercises. |
| Resistance Levels | Numerous resistance levels allow for different workouts, catering to both newbies and advanced bicyclists. |
| Digital Display | A display that tracks time, distance, calories burned, and heart rate helps in keeping track of progress. |
| Size and Portability | Guarantee that the bike fits your space and can be moved quickly if required. |
| Integrated Programs | Pre-set workout programs can assist keep exercises engaging and challenging. |
| Connection | Lots of bikes now have Bluetooth capabilities and can connect to apps for improved tracking and virtual classes. |

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How frequently should I use my stationary bicycle?
For weight loss and physical fitness improvement, goal for a minimum of 150 minutes of moderate aerobic exercise or 75 minutes of energetic exercise per week. This can be divided into much shorter sessions based on your schedule.
2. Do stationary bicycle actually assist in weight reduction?
Yes! Stationary bicycle can be reliable for weight loss. When combined with a healthy diet and routine exercise, you can burn significant calories, leading to weight loss over time.
3. Can I use an exercise bike if I have joint discomfort?
Yes, stationary bicycle offer a low-impact exercise that is simpler on the joints than running or high-impact exercises. Recumbent bikes are especially beneficial for those with back or joint pain.
4. Are expensive exercise bikes worth the financial investment?
Higher-end bikes normally feature more functions, much better construct quality, and durability. Consider your budget and how often you plan to utilize the bike. Quality typically leads to a much better exercise experience.
5. What is the very best kind of stationary bicycle for newbies?
Upright bikes are normally suggested for beginners, as they offer a straightforward and comfy cycling experience. Nevertheless, recumbent bikes can likewise be a terrific choice for those searching for additional back assistance.
